I was waiting for my salad at McDonalds when I noticed the Minute Maid Lemonade Drink spigot at the self-serve counter for soda.
It had three lemons in the logo, right above the text "0% Real Juice."
That's right. No juice at all. But three lemons right under the "Minute Maid" on the label.
Why not put three truck tires, or three hamsters, or even three sofas?
How about three test tubes or vials full of powdery compounds?
